Transaction 306eabbb731efb13318bec289c3e3fdb75d9b2810a074fc12fb8cdc1b8d03411
1 Input
1 Output
-
306eabbb731efb13318bec289c3e3fdb75d9b2810a074fc12fb8cdc1b8d03411:0
- value
- 10673144
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dd102a7de3e9cfcf816f6985efa4c7050013dda
- address
- bc1q3hgs9f7786w0e7qk76v9a7jvwpgqz0w6nlpypr